“Strong demand growth is needed to reduce what still appears a very large oil overhang,” Kevin Norrish, head of commodities research at Barclays, said in the article.

The El Nino weather phenomenon is affecting weather conditions and cutting into the supply outlook on agricultural products. [Great Grains: Dueling Views on Ag Commodity ETFs]

“Extreme weather from El Niño may be the biggest driving force in the solid gains for every single one of the eight commodities in the sector in June,” Jodie Gunzberg, global head of commodities at S&P Dow Jones Indices, said in the FT article.

Meanwhile, industrial metals are at the mercy of fluctuations in China. The subdued economic data from China added to concerns about global growth, along with demand for other raw resources that fuel the growth.
